TT is showing incorrect amounts on amended return for the State

I filed my 2021 taxes under an extension and had to make payments in 2022 at the time the 2021 extension was filed.  These payments were about $1,500 Fed and $4700 State.  My original 2022 return that I recently filed included (incorrectly) these payments made with the Extensions as Estimated Taxes paid.   This incorrectly resulted in about $700 taxes due for the feds and $2500 refund for state, which I applied to my 2023 state taxes.  Now that I have discovered my error, I am trying to file an amended return for both.  When I removed both of the Extension payments amounts from the Estimated Taxes Section, TT showed the correct additional amount due for the Feds, which is exactly the amount of the removed payment ($1,500).  However, TT is showing the State additional payment as the full amount of the removed payment ($4,700), when it should be $2,500 (refund)-$4,700 new taxes=$2,200 due.  Do anyone know how I can correct this in TT?  I have looked at the TT amendment section for 2 hours and can't make it show the correct amount.  Please help!  Thanks.

TT is showing incorrect amounts on amended return for the State

Everyone,

 

I got this figured out.  The PDF (and source data) in TT is correct.  However, the little preview windows at the top of the screen (with red or green text) are wrong, since they assume that refunds are already received and paid even if you applied it to a future return.   So, everyone should be aware that the little windows at the top of the screen (with red or green text) on the can show incorrect numbers when you do an Amended Return depending on what you selected for your refund option.  

TT is showing incorrect amounts on amended return for the State

Never pay attention to the Refund-O-Meter when amending the return ... it will only confuse you.  

 

Look at the form 1040X …

Column A should have the figures from the original return, Column C the corrected figures and Column B the differences between the other 2 which needs an explanation on page 2 of the form 1040X.

If you completed it correctly you will see an entry on either line 16 OR 18:

On line 16 should be the amount you paid with your original return. If you paid nothing already then this line should be zero.

On line 18 should be the amount of your original refund you received.  If you have not received your refund yet then you need to wait for it.  If the refund changes from what you expected then this line must reflect that change.

Then you will see your extra refund on line 22 OR  the new balance due you need to pay on line 20.
